Output 521ffd141c6e674e580529685405bd45c94d46ce0c5a9c69e076ef2a2cbeacc7:1

value
50634000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c45d5416f60ce609629faaaff2bb919189680a OP_EQUAL
address
ABU8SwT2a513g1pikCB5DjC1t2DoCUwGRg
transaction
521ffd141c6e674e580529685405bd45c94d46ce0c5a9c69e076ef2a2cbeacc7